AFFORDABILITY
Financial
assistance is available to degree-seeking students enrolled full time
in the MAE program. Two full-credit courses per trimester is considered
full time.
You may be eligible for financial aid including state and federal loans or grants. If your employer provides tuition assistance, you can participate in Augsburg's employer tuition reimbursement program. We also offer several scholarships and tuition discounts which may be available to you.

Minnesota Indian Teacher Training Grant and Loan Program
A partnership with the Minneapolis and St. Paul Public Schools, the program's goal is to increase the number of American Indian teachers in these districts. The financial aid package includes a combination of special grants and student loans. The loans are forgiven based on the number of years the student teaches in the Minneapolis or St. Paul district after obtaining an Augsburg education degree and meeting the state licensing requirements.
AmeriCorps Discount
AmeriCorps volunteers who have served at least half-time
for one year, who are qualified for admission to Augsburg College,
and who enroll within five years of the completion of their service
may receive a 25% tuition credit for one course each term in Augsburg’s
graduate or Weekend College program. For more information, contact
the Graduate Admissions Office.
Military Discount
Individuals who are serving or have served in the military,
and spouses of those currently serving, may qualify for 10% off of
tuition. For more information, contact the Graduate
Admissions Office.
